Can you drink Ka'Chava every day safely?

For most people, incorporating one serving of Ka'Chava into their daily routine is safe and can provide a nutritional boost. However, it's crucial to understand how to use it as part of a balanced diet, rather than relying on it as a sole source of nutrition. The product is designed to be an "all-in-one" shake, packed with protein, fiber, greens, and other nutrients, but it is not a calorie-dense meal replacement on its own. For long-term health, a varied diet from whole foods is always recommended.

Benefits of daily Ka'Chava consumption

Integrating Ka'Chava into your daily diet can offer several advantages. A daily shake can help bridge nutritional gaps for those who struggle to eat a wide variety of fruits and vegetables, containing 25 grams of plant-based protein and fortified with 26 essential vitamins and minerals. The formula also includes prebiotic fiber, probiotics, and digestive enzymes that may promote gut health and regularity. The balanced macronutrient profile can also help provide sustained energy. When used in a calorie-controlled plan, its protein and fiber content may assist with weight management by promoting fullness.

Potential drawbacks and side effects

While generally well-tolerated, daily consumption can have some drawbacks. Some individuals may experience mild digestive issues like bloating or gas due to the high fiber or certain ingredients. It's advised to start with a smaller serving to help your body adjust. With approximately 240 calories per serving, Ka'Chava is often not enough to fully replace a meal without adding other foods. The specific quantities of ingredients in its proprietary blends are not fully disclosed, which can make it hard to gauge their exact impact. As it contains coconut milk, it is not suitable for those with tree nut allergies.

Making Ka'Chava part of your routine

To drink Ka'Chava every day successfully, it is best used as a nutritional supplement or to replace a single, less-healthy meal or snack. Customizing shakes with ingredients like nut butters, fruits, or avocado can increase caloric density if needed. Consulting a healthcare provider is recommended for those with specific health conditions, allergies, or for pregnant/breastfeeding individuals. Ka'Chava's support channels advise against using it as your sole source of nutrition.
